生产补料单明细查询
获取生产补料单明细数据
| 基本信息
| 信息 | 值 | 备注 |
|---|---|---|
| 接口名称 | 生产补料单明细查询 | 根据单据ID、单据NO来查询单据明细信息 |
| 请求状态 | POST | RESTful方式 |
| 接口路径 | http://localhost:23798/api/Bill/QueryBillDetail | 向服务器地址发送POST请求 |
| 远程模式 | http://www.linkerplus.com/api/ext_erp/Bill/QueryBillDetail | 远程模式向服务器地址发送POST请求,需要ERP注册号注册远程模式,并在Headers添加sn参数 |
| 支持日期 | 2022-08-05 | 自该日期起支持 |
| 请求参数
Headers
| 参数名称 | 是否必须 | 参数值 | 备注 |
|---|---|---|---|
| Content-Type | 是 | application/json | 用于指定数据的传输类型 |
| LoginId | 是 | e835943e-55c2-4bf0-832d-6f4166592941 | 用户登录的LoginId,取用户登录或账套验证接口返回的LoginId |
| sn | 否 | MGR_REST_1001 | 远程模式需添加sn参数,MGR_REST_ERP注册号 |
Body
| 参数名称 | 类型 | 是否必须 | 参数值 | 备注 | 其它信息 |
|---|---|---|---|---|---|
| CallId | string | 是 | M3 | 调用的单据识别号 | "M3":表示生产补料单 |
| CallNo | string | 是 | M30C240001 | 调用的单据号码 | |
| UsrNo | string | 否 | ADMIN | 操作员 | 账套验证的LoginId需添加UsrNo,用户登录的LoginId则无需添加UsrNo |
| EntryOrderId | string | 否 | WMS00001 | 调用方业务编码 | 当调用方通过接口保存单据时EntryOrderId不为空,则可以使用EntryOrderId来查询ERP中的单据,无需传CallId与CallNo。当关联不到ERP单据时返回提示EntryOrderId无效 |
| 返回数据
| 参数名称 | 类型 | 参数值 | 备注 |
|---|---|---|---|
| CallID | string | M3 | 调用的单据识别号 |
| CallNO | string | M30C240001 | 调用的单据号码 |
| CallOK | string | T | 执行是否成功,是:"T" 否:"F" |
| Data | object | 单据信息,json格式 | |
| ErrorStr | string | 错误信息 |
| 调用范例
Request
无需赋值的字段不需要添加
{
"CallId": "M3", //必须,调用的单据识别号
"CallNo": "M30C240001", //必须,调用的单据号码
"UsrNo": "ADMIN" //非必须,操作员
}
保存单据时EntryOrderId不为空,则可以使用EntryOrderId来查询ERP中的单据
{
"EntryOrderId": "WMS00001", //必须,调用方业务编码
"UsrNo": "ADMIN" //非必须,操作员
}
Response
{
"CallID": "M3", //调用的单据识别号
"CallNO": "M30C240001", //调用的单据号码
"CallOK": "T", //执行是否成功, 是:"T" 否:"F"
"Data": { //单据信息
"HEADDATA": { //表头信息
"USR": "ADMIN", //制单人
"REM": "", //备注
"DEP": "0000", //部门
"MT_NO": "", //发料计划单号
"ML_NO": "M30C240001", //领料单号
"ML_ID": "3", //领/退注记(1.领料2.退料3.补料4.托领5.托退6.托补MG返工领料)
"ML_DD": "2022-07-06", //领料日期
"CLS_DATE": "2022-07-06", //终审日期
"CUS_NO": "", //托工厂商
"BIL_TYPE": "", //单据类别
"PRT_SW": "N", //打印注记
"BIL_NO": "", //来源单号
"BIL_ID": "", //识别码
"CHK_MAN": "ADMIN", //审核
"FT_ID": "", //分摊标志
"EFF_DD": "2022-07-06 11:08:11", //生效日期
"VOH_NO": "", //凭证模版
"VOH_ID": "", //模版代号
"USR_NO": "", //经办人
"LOCK_MAN": "", //锁单人
"WH_MTL": "" //原料仓
},
"BODYDATA1": [ //表身信息
{
"PRD_NO_CHG": "2", //替代品
"NAME_MRP": "", //订单货品名
"NAME_ENG": "", //货品英文名称
"SEQ_ITM": "0", //序列号关联项
"UP_STD_UNIT": "", //单位标准成本
"SEQ_BIL_NO": "", //序列号来源单单号
"SEQ_BIL_ID": "", //序列号来源单识别号
"PZ_NO": "", //制令单(依模具)
"SPC": "", //货品规格
"REM": "", //备注
"QTY": "10", //数量
"ITM": "1", //项
"CST": "0", //成本
"ORI_PRD_NO": "0034", //原单被替代货品
"UP_CST": "0", //单位成本
"BAT_NO": "", //批号
"QTY_UT": "1", //单位用量
"QTY_ML": "", //领料套数(已不使用)
"QTY_LM": "10", //批次领料应发量
"TCODE_CHK": "", //是否已经确认(Tcode)
"MO_NO": "MO27060001", //制令单号
"ML_NO": "M30C240001", //领料单号
"ML_ID": "3", //领退注记
"ML_DD": "2022-07-06", //领料日期
"SEQ_ORI_ITM": "", //来源单序列号关联项
"PreView_Prd_Pic": "", //货品图片
"UP_CST_UT": "0", //主单位成本
"SEFF_DATE": "2022-07-06 11:07:50", //来源单生效日期
"OLD_QTY": "10", //旧数量
"PRE_ITM": "1", //原单项次,用作后续关联的项次
"MRP_NO": "0033", //成品代号
"CST_STD": "0", //标准成本
"PRD_NO": "0035", //料号
"PRD_LOC": "", //储位
"FORMULA_CSV": "", //保存副单位参数
"QTY_RTN": "0", //已发数
"QTY_RSV": "10", //应发数
"WH": "0000", //仓库
"EST_ITM": "1", //转入项次,追踪来源单的项次
"PRD_NAME": "0035", //料名
"PRD_MARK": "", //料件特征
"UP1_CST": "", //单位成本(副)
"OBJ_CLASS": "", //项目类型
"ISREPL": "True", //存在替代
"ISMAKE": "False", //是否成品或半成品
"CUS_NAME": "", //需求客户
"TZ_NO": "", //通知单号
"UNIT": "1", //单位
"USEIN_NO": "", //组装位置
"QTY1": "", //数量1
"EFF_DD": "2022-07-06 11:08:11", //生效日期
"MRP_NO_SO": "", //订单货品
"QTY1_TCODE": "", //确认数量(副)
"ML_QTY": "10", //已领套数
"CONFIRMFLAG": "", //确认更改标记
"QTY_TCODE": "", //确认数量
"OBJ_NO": "", //项目代号
}
]
},
"ErrorStr": "" //错误信息
}
| 备注
- 必须在Headers里面传入用户登录或账套验证的
LoginId。 - 当采用的是账套验证获取的
LoginId,那么UsrNo就是操作员,不能为空。采用用户登录的LoginId则无需添加UsrNo,用户即操作员。